Quartz 是一个开源的作业调度框架,它完全由 Java 写成,并设计用于 J2SE 和 J2EE 应用中。它提供了巨大的灵活性而不牺牲简单性。你能够用它来为执行一个作业而创建简单的或复杂的调度。 在项目中有大量的后台任务需要调度执行,如构建索引、统计报表、周期同步数据等等,要求任务调度系统具备高可用性、负载均衡特性,使用Quartz 会很方便。 下文是spring和quartz进行整合,同时
# Java连接OpenGauss集群指南 在现代企业中,数据库的使用是必不可少的。而OpenGauss作为一种新兴的开源分布式数据库,因其高性能、可扩展性等特点受到广泛关注。本文旨在指导如何用Java连接OpenGauss集群。从建立连接到执行查询,我们将一步一步进行探讨。 ## 连接流程概述 在开始之前,首先了解我们需要进行的步骤。以下是连接OpenGauss的基本流程: | 步骤 |
原创 7月前
96阅读
Java连接Zookeeper一、配置zk环境本人使用的是虚拟机,创建了两台linux服务器(安装过程百度上很多)准备zk的安装包,zookeeper-3.4.10.tar.gz,可在Apache官网下载,这里我提供了一个百度云的https://pan.baidu.com/s/15icVROSKpgwUzqzpHW6Rbg 密码dgnp安装过程 环境准备:安装JDK,配置Hosts,配置H
openGauss是华为基于postgresql内核开发的应用于oltp场景的开源关系型数据库,本次搭建基于openGauss-1.0.0环境准备主机ip配置用途10.0.61.190Centos7.6 1C/8G/50G主节点10.0.61.191Centos7.6 1C/8G/50G从节点安装前置操作关闭防火墙systemctl disable firewalld.servicesystemc
原创 2021-03-01 19:16:43
1131阅读
openGauss是华为基于postgresql内核开发的应用于oltp场景的开源关系型数据库,本次搭建基于openGauss-1.0.0环境准备主机ip配置用途10.0.61.190Centos7.6 1C/8G/50G主节点10.0.61.191Centos7.6 1C/8G/50G从节点安装前置操作关闭防火墙systemctl disable firewalld.servicesystemc
原创 2021-03-11 10:04:57
994阅读
新建一个Maven工程,工程结构如下:然后在pom文件添加如下依赖:<dependency> <groupId>junit</groupId> <artifactId>junit</artifactId> <version>4.12</version> <!-- <sco
转载 2023-06-18 23:51:12
149阅读
部分非原创内容已添加原地址Spring:spring是一个框架,包含spring framwork,spring boot,spring cloud等.核心特性是ioc(控制反转)和aop(面向切面编程).IOC.依赖对象的创建不是由调用者完成,而是有IOC容器完成并注入到调用者.容器在对象初始化时不等对象请求就主动将依赖传递给它.AOP.是对OOP(面向对象)的一种补充,用于处理一些具有横切性质
【我和openGauss的故事】openGauss容灾集群搭建过程代码学习记录ziyoo0830 [openGauss](javascript:void(0);) 2023-08-03 16:49 发表于四川gs_sdr命令代码解读背景openGauss推出了容灾架构,相比之前的一个集群主从架构,而容灾架构是两个集群间的数据同步。为了更深入了解其原理,本文试图通过阅读gs_sdr命令相关的代码来学
原创 2023-08-09 14:35:40
84阅读
注:本文所有操作都使用管理员权限su root输入密码1.打开对应的端口- 既所有集群的端口号全部都打开 / 安装Jdk----暂时使用openJDK可行/sbin/iptables -I INPUT -p tcp --dport 80 -j ACCEPT #开启80端口 /etc/rc.d/init.d/iptables save #保存配置 /etc/rc.d/init.d/iptables
OpenGauss 是一个开源的关系型数据库管理系统,它与 PostgreSQL 兼容,并在性能、安全性和可扩展性上进行了优化。而 VS Code 是一个轻量级的代码编辑器,它提供了丰富的扩展插件,方便开发人员进行代码编写和调试。在这篇文章中,我们将介绍如何使用 VS Code 进行 OpenGauss 数据库的开发和调试。 ## 安装和配置 首先,你需要下载并安装 VS Code 编辑器。你
原创 2024-01-15 22:31:47
176阅读
# Java代码连接Kafka集群配置指南 在大数据处理场景中,Apache Kafka 是一个广泛使用的消息队列解决方案。对于初学者来说,连接到Kafka集群可能会让人感到困惑。本文将为你详细介绍如何在Java中连接Kafka集群配置步骤,并附上示例代码。 ## 连接Kafka的流程 以下是连接Kafka的主要步骤: | 步骤 | 描述
原创 9月前
391阅读
在使用Jedis的过程中最简单的用法就是单实例单连接的jedis,如下代码所示:public void testJedis(){ Jedis jedis = new Jedis("127.0.0.1"); jedis.set("key", "value"); jedis.get("key"); jedis.close(); }让我们深入到内部去看一看其结构
转载 2023-12-19 21:58:45
66阅读
本文介绍了SpringBoot如何解析配置类、如何集成第三方配置。 SpringBoot作为Java领域非常流行的开源框架,集成了大量常用的第三方库配置,Spring Boot应用中这些第三方库几乎可以是零配置的开箱即用,大部分的 Spring Boot 应用都只需要非常少量的配置代码,开发者能够更加专注于业务逻辑。SpringBoot上手快,但是如果你
转载 7月前
69阅读
# Redisson集群代码配置详解 Redisson是一个基于Redis的分布式Java对象和服务框架,提供了一系列的分布式功能和数据结构。其中,Redisson集群是Redisson框架中一个重要的特性,它可以让我们方便地在分布式环境中使用Redis。 本文将详细介绍Redisson集群代码配置,并提供相应的代码示例。我们将从以下几个方面进行介绍: 1. Redisson集群的概念和原
原创 2023-09-23 17:20:03
114阅读
  AOP通知Spring中常用的AOP通知有五种:前置通知:在某方法调用之前执行;后置通知:在后方法调用之后执行;异常通知:在某方法发生异常时执行;返回通知:在某方法进行返回时执行;环绕通知:可手动进行控制以上四种通知的执行;AOP配置    加入一下spring的jar包:    配置文件中引入xmlns
转载 4月前
34阅读
如何实现opengauss replication源代码 概述: opengauss replication是一个用于数据复制和同步的工具。它可以实现将数据从一个数据库复制到另一个数据库,确保数据的一致性和可用性。本文将介绍如何使用opengauss replication源代码实现数据复制的过程。 流程: 下表展示了使用opengauss replication源代码实现数据复制的步骤。
原创 2024-01-12 23:19:42
74阅读
一、通信管理openGauss查询响应是使用简单的“单一用户对应一个服务器线程”的客户端/服务器模型实现的。由于我们无法提前知道需要建立多少个连接,因此必须使用主进程(GaussMaster)主进程在指定的TCP/IP(Transmission Control Protocol/Internet Protocol,传输控制协议/互联网协议)端口上侦听传入的连接,只要检测到连接请求,主进程就会生成一
原创 精选 2023-03-09 10:01:40
973阅读
概述.     Osg 即OpenSceneGraph的简称.是一款开源的场景图形库.同时它也是跨平台的..Osg它基于场景图的概念.利用了软件开发当中的设计模式的理念,设计并提供了一个基于OpenGL底层的面向对象的图形开发框架..     Osg是完全由标准C++和OpenGL而写的.充分利用STL和设计模式的特性
# MySQL配置集群Java代码调整 随着系统需求的不断增加,数据库的性能瓶颈成为了开发者面临的一大挑战。为了解决这一问题,搭建数据库集群成为了一种常见的解决方案。本文将介绍如何在配置MySQL集群后调整Java代码,以便更好地适应集群环境。 ## 什么是MySQL集群? MySQL集群是通过将多个MySQL数据库服务器组合在一起,来实现数据的冗余和负载均衡。通常,MySQL集群分为主从
原创 2024-10-01 06:26:23
86阅读
简介之前公司用的是Consul进行服务发现以及服务管理,自己一直以来只是用一下,但是没有具体的深入,觉得学习不可以这样,所以稍微研究了一下。网上有很多关于Consul的介绍和对比,我这里也不献丑了,大家搜索的时候可能会经常看到这么一个表格,此表格采摘自:https://luyiisme.github.io/2017/04/22/spring-cloud-service-discovery-prod
  • 1
  • 2
  • 3
  • 4
  • 5